GPN01530 is a fibroblast activation protein (FAP)-targeted radiopharmaceutical drug conjugate (RDC) being developed by Grand Pharma in collaboration with Serilink Biotechnology. The drug consists of a small molecule ligand designed to bind with high affinity to FAP, a cell-surface serine protease that is highly expressed on cancer-associated fibroblasts (CAFs) within the tumor stroma of various solid tumors, while remaining largely absent in normal tissues. By targeting the tumor microenvironment, GPN01530 delivers a therapeutic radioactive payload directly to the site of the tumor, aiming to induce DNA damage and cell death in both FAP-expressing stromal cells and adjacent malignant cells via the bystander effect. The program has received FDA IND approval for Phase 1/2 clinical trials in patients with solid tumors. A companion diagnostic version, GPN01530-2, is also in development for patient selection and imaging.
